Aircraft Mechanic I (Aircrew Flight Equipment)

       

Primary responsibilities:

Inspects, evaluates and repairs survival equipment for assigned aircraft and support equipment. Use approved material to upholster, repair or replace aircraft furnishings, headliners, interior side panels,

and bulkheads. Install carpeting, floor coverings and vinyl on SAM aircraft. Repair, manufacture, repack and sew fabric, canvas, leather, rubber and other synthetic material IAW tech data.

Inspect, repair and repack emergency life rafts and life preservers. Modify, design and fabricate any canvas, leather, rubber or synthetic fabric items in support of aircraft maintenance including but not limited to interior furnishings and floor coverings.  Operates all associated ground support equipment. Maintains oxygen masks, hand tools, power tools,

special cutting tools, fasteners and adhesives applicable to repair and maintenance assigned aircraft. Evaluates, designs, and manufactures logistics improvement projects. Researches technical data for maintenance, and repair of assigned aircraft and associated equipment.

Uses maintenance drawings and blueprints to accomplish repairs on assigned equipment. Performs on-equipment evaluations of aircraft interior components to determine serviceability and or repair-ability. Coordinates maintenance efforts with the Production Supervisors and Maintenance Operation Coordination Center.

Documents discrepancies in applicable forms and inputs data in Maintenance Information System. Ensures compliance with applicable safety, housekeeping, tool control, and FOD prevention programs. Must be able to work day, swing, night, and/or weekend shifts as required. Performs other

duties related to the occupational field as assigned to include temporary duty and travel. Must maintain all training requirements.

Must have a working knowledge of applicable technical publications and repair procedures for survival equipment.
Must have a working knowledge of corrosion control techniques and base, federal and Company procedures for handling and disposal of hazardous waste materials.
Must be fluent in English.
Must be able to read and interpret technical data.
Must have a valid driver’s license 
Must be able to obtain and maintain a Secret security clearance.

Physical Requirements:

Must pass Pulmonary Fit Test and wear breathable oxygen mask in the performance of certain maintenance operations.
Must be able to lift 50 pounds.
